Kingswinford

Kingswinford is a suburban area of the West Midlands, by the cities of the industrial Black Country, including Birmingham and Wolverhampton. Kingswinford, however is much more rural, incorporating a knot of smaller villages, and bordering a green belt that stretches along the Severn Valley far into Wales. The town houses the Broadfield House Glass Museum, which displays a large collection of locally produced glass in a Grade II listed building.

With excellent transport links, ample amenities, a choice of quality accommodation and a good range of shops, pubs and restaurants, Kingswinford presents and excellent vantage point from which to explore the wider region of the West Midlands. Attractions of the local region include: the Birmingham Hippodrome, the Black Country Living Museum, Drayton Manor Theme Park, and the Royal Air Force Museum in Cosford.
